How they compare

United States of America currently reports 39,746 cubic meters per person against 34,692 cubic meters per person in Malaysia, a difference of 5,054 cubic meters per person.

That makes United States of America's figure about 1.1 times Malaysia's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 41 shared years of data; in 1980 it was Malaysia ahead.

Malaysia ranks 26th and United States of America ranks 25th of 200 countries.

Across the 5 decades both report, Malaysia averaged higher in 4 and United States of America in 1.

Head to head by decade

Decade Malaysia United States of America Difference Ahead
1980s 71,324 cubic meters per person 23,237 cubic meters per person 48,087 cubic meters per person Malaysia
1990s 96,755 cubic meters per person 17,769 cubic meters per person 78,986 cubic meters per person Malaysia
2000s 86,739 cubic meters per person 19,143 cubic meters per person 67,596 cubic meters per person Malaysia
2010s 57,607 cubic meters per person 30,599 cubic meters per person 27,007 cubic meters per person Malaysia
2020s 34,897 cubic meters per person 39,746 cubic meters per person 4,849 cubic meters per person United States of America

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
